In today’s rapidly evolving workplace, leadership development has never been more critical. Yet there is a worrying gap between the leadership development young professionals are receiving and what they actually need to succeed.
In fact, 63% of Millennials aren’t receiving the leadership development they need to advance in their careers. This highlights a critical shortfall in the training and support that young professionals need in order to grow into effective leaders.
Even more concerning is the fact that only 12% of companies have confidence in the strength of their leadership bench. This means that the majority of organisations are facing a leadership pipeline crisis, with a lack of qualified leaders to step into key roles as their current leaders retire or transition away.
The importance of leadership development
It’s clear that businesses recognise the importance of developing their future leaders. In fact, 83% of companies acknowledge that leadership development is a top priority. Yet, despite this awareness, the majority of organisations are failing to offer the robust leadership programs necessary to address this issue.
CEOs and HR leaders must take immediate action to build leadership programs that cater to all levels. The future of any organisation depends on its ability to nurture the leadership talent of tomorrow.
The education sector needs to prepare young people with top-notch employability skills to put them on the leadership pathway, and organisations need to invest in leadership development programmes to prepare the leaders of tomorrow with the skills and confidence they need to drive success in an increasingly complex world.
